@ -5700,6 +5700,23 @@ ix86_output_function_epilogue (FILE *file ATTRIBUTE_UNUSED,
{
if (pic_offset_table_rtx)
REGNO (pic_offset_table_rtx) = REAL_PIC_OFFSET_TABLE_REGNUM;
#if TARGET_MACHO
/* Mach-O doesn't support labels at the end of objects, so if
it looks like we might want one, insert a NOP. */
{
rtx insn = get_last_insn ();
while (insn
&& NOTE_P (insn)
&& NOTE_LINE_NUMBER (insn) != NOTE_INSN_DELETED_LABEL)
insn = PREV_INSN (insn);
if (insn
&& (LABEL_P (insn)
|| (NOTE_P (insn)
&& NOTE_LINE_NUMBER (insn) == NOTE_INSN_DELETED_LABEL)))
fputs ("\tnop\n", file);
}
#endif
}
